In 2013, the woman saw Agent Grant Ward "stealing" an alien artifact from a safe in Paris, France.
Character's evolution
Agent Grant Ward manages to open a safe hidden behind a fireplace. Then the woman appears wearing a housecoat, surprised by the presence of Ward. Ward tells her that the fireplace is broken. She leaves the room when two men come in the room and attack Ward.
A few moments later, the woman leaves the apartment while Ward is still defending himself against the two men.
Behind the scenes
- Sarah Dumont is credited as "Beautiful Woman" in the episode's ending credits.
